# Note: pending imminent deprecation **This module will be deprecated once npm v7 is released. Please do not rely on it more than absolutely necessary.** The lifecycle script runner used in npm v7 is [@npmcli/run-script](http://npm.im/@npmcli/run-script). Please use that module moving forward. ----- # npm-lifecycle [`npm-lifecycle`](https://github.com/npm/npm-lifecycle) is a standalone library for executing packages' lifecycle scripts. It is extracted from npm itself and intended to be fully compatible with the way npm executes individual scripts. ## Install `$ npm install npm-lifecycle` ## Table of Contents * [Example](#example) * [Features](#features) * [Contributing](#contributing) * [API](#api) * [`lifecycle`](#lifecycle) ### Example ```javascript // idk yet ``` ### API #### <a name="lifecycle"></a> `> lifecycle(name, pkg, wd, [opts]) -> Promise` ##### Arguments * `opts.stdio` - the [stdio](https://nodejs.org/api/child_process.html#child_process_options_stdio) passed to the child process. `[0, 1, 2]` by default. ##### Example ```javascript lifecycle() ```
